Job Summary

Own and scale the data driven marketing analytics program by partnering across teams, building data models, and delivering insights to influence strategy.

  • Own and drive cross-functional partnerships to translate business needs into analytics solutions.
  • Lead data integration, segmentation, and reporting efforts to inform marketing decisions.

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Establish and foster partnerships across the organization to understand marketing objectives and business requirements
  • Lead the creation and execution of solutions to pull and combine data from multiple sources for customer behavior analytics, campaign measurement, and reporting
  • Analyze customer journeys, digital engagement, and campaign performance to identify actionable insights
  • Develop and implement customer segmentation and targeting strategies to optimize marketing effectiveness
  • Communicate insights to senior leaders via written and oral presentations, influencing marketing strategy and investment decisions
  • Collaborate with analytic and non-analytic groups to facilitate holistic, cross-functional learning
  • Champion data and analytics best practices across the marketing organization
  • Translate business needs into data models supporting long-term marketing solutions
  • Facilitate the creation of data models using best practices to ensure high data quality and reduced redundancy

Requirements

  • Master’s degree in a relevant quantitative field (e.g., Statistics, Economics, Marketing Analytics, Mathematics, Engineering, Computer Science, or related fields)
  • 6+ years of industry experience in marketing analytics roles (e.g., digital analytics, campaign measurement, customer insights)
  • 6+ years of work experience across a broad range of analytics platforms, languages, and tools (Snowflake, Alteryx, SAS, Tableau, Python, Excel Pivot, etc.); hands-on experience using big data platforms required
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to convey complex information in an understandable, compelling, and persuasive manner to business partners
  • Innovative thinking capability to help internal clients define marketing problems, create solutions, and execute implementation
  • Expert knowledge in quantitative methods for marketing analytics, including customer segmentation, targeting, and digital analytics

Preferred

  • Financial services experience, especially in credit card marketing analytics
